private static SVNLog SharpSVNToSVNLog(Source source, Collection<SvnLogEventArgs> collection, SVNInfo info, Collection<SvnStatusEventArgs> statusCollection) { SVNLog log = new SVNLog(); Dictionary<string, SvnStatusEventArgs> statusMap = GetStatusMap(statusCollection); foreach (SvnLogEventArgs logItem in collection) { DateTime localTime = logItem.Time.ToLocalTime(); SVNLogEntry entry = new SVNLogEntry(source, logItem.Revision, logItem.Author, localTime, logItem.LogMessage); SvnChangeItemCollection items = logItem.ChangedPaths; if (items != null) { List<SVNPath> paths = new List<SVNPath>(); foreach (SvnChangeItem item in items) { SVNPath path = new SVNPath(entry, SVNActionConverter.ToSVNAction(item.Action), item.Path); string pathName = item.Path; if (pathName.StartsWith("/")) { pathName = pathName.Substring(1); } string pathUri = info.RepositoryRoot + pathName; path.Uri = pathUri; if (statusMap.ContainsKey(pathUri)) { SvnStatusEventArgs statusItem = statusMap[pathUri]; path.FilePath = statusItem.FullPath; } else { string filePath = SVNPath.GuessFilePath(entry, path.Name, info); if (FileSystemHelper.Exists(filePath)) { path.FilePath = filePath; } else { path.FilePath = pathUri; } } paths.Add(path); } entry.Paths = paths; log.LogEntries.Add(entry); } } return log; }
